#9 WWE Women's Tag Team Champion Nia Jax is self-isolating

It was revealed at Clash of Champions that the WWE Women's Tag Team Champions had not been medically cleared to compete. This meant they were unable to defend their titles in their scheduled match against The Riott Squad.

Charly Caruso said that there would be more of an update on RAW, but it appears that the main update surrounding the two women is that they aren't injured. Instead, they have been exposed to someone who tested positive for COVID-19 and will now be forced to self isolate for two weeks.

It's unclear what this means for the Women's Tag Team Championship picture for the next few weeks. However, given that the two women are isolating and missed Clash of Champions, it's expected that they will only miss one more episode of RAW. That's as long as neither woman begins showing symptoms.

Nia Jax has been very vocal on her Twitter account recently. She has made it clear that she isn't being sidelined because of anything that's affecting her health, but it's just WWE taking a precaution.
